Located in Canberra, the National Museum of Australia is dedicated to preserving and showcasing the nation’s social history. Through engaging exhibitions and displays, the museum explores the people, events, and key issues that have shaped Australia’s identity. It was officially established under the National Museum of Australia Act 1980. To learn more, visit: https://www.nma.gov.au
